Default Bought A complete (Front and rear) Integra disc brake changeover! Help! ADvice!

I just bought a front and rear 90-93 integra disc conversion for $200 CDN!

INcludes everything! but i have a lot of questions!

1) The first question has to do with these pics.




What are those cables for? Are they abs? If so can i run them on my car without using them? (Can i unbolt them?!)

2) Will i be able to reuse my axles?

3) Do I have to use the UCA from the integras or can i use the ones from my crx?

4)How do you re-route the integra e brake cables? Anyone have pics?

5) ALSO MY CAR IS LOWERED ON HR RACE SPRINGS AND KONI YELLOWS.....
ARE THE KNUCKLES GOING TO BE A PROBLEM?!

Thats all i can thinik of for now! If i have any more questions ill let you guys know!

Thanks!

Those rubber "cables" are actually brake fluid hoses that go to the rear calipers. You'll need to get new lines because it looks like those were just cut. There should be another hose which the E brake cable goes through into the back of the hub.

By the way is this a rear disk conversion??? or all 4? If it's just rears then you dont worry about axels, jus swap the hub/trailing arm and bolt up...LCA's should be the same (not 100%)...

You can keep the 90-93 Integra knuckles, just get an alignment after it's done. The EX knuckles people recommend are 90-91 EX Civic sedan knuckles. Yes you can still use your axles.
